Output 8b5fe7433219a382603371327e1a4c843a3a2cdd2c7bb77391feb910c8d8bedf:0

value
13453506
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56515050f3e3417ef0899b7d2ab6c7613daa83c0 OP_EQUALVERIFY OP_CHECKSIG
address
18sQXGwPQBJkWXuGCWdHX2wkzNoy83wtKT
transaction
8b5fe7433219a382603371327e1a4c843a3a2cdd2c7bb77391feb910c8d8bedf
confirmations
258500
spent
true